The decomposition of azodicarbonamide, used as foaming agent in PVC—plasticizer (1/1) plastisols was studied by DSC. Nineteen different plasticizers, all belonging to the ester family, two being polymeric (polyadipates), were compared. The temperature of maximum decomposition rate (in anisothermal regime at 5 K min−1 scanning rate), ranges between 434 and 452 K. The heat of decomposition ranges between 8.7 and 12.5 J g−1. Some trends of variation of these parameters appear significant and are discussed in terms of solvent (matrix) and viscosity effects on the decomposition reactions. The shear modulus at 1 Hz frequency was determined at the temperature of maximum rate of foaming agent decomposition, and differs significantly from a sample to another. The foam density was determined at ambient temperature and the volume fraction of bubbles was used as criterion to judge the efficiency of the foaming process. The results reveal the existence of an optimal shear modulus of the order of 2 kPa that corresponds roughly to plasticizer molar masses of the order of 450 ± 50 g mol−1. Heavier plasticizers, especially polymeric ones are too difficult to deform. Lighter plasticizers such as diethyl phthalate (DEP) deform too easily and presumably facilitate bubble collapse.

The thermal multicomponent 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ition (1,3-DC) of diethyl aminomalonate or α-amino esters (derived from glycine, alanine, phenylalanine, and phenylglycine) with ethyl glyoxylate and the corresponding dipolarophile such as maleimides, methyl acrylate, methyl fumarate, (E)-1,2-bis(phenylsulfonyl)ethylene, and electron deficient alkynes allows the diastereoselective synthesis of new polysubstituted pyrrolidine derivatives. Microwave-assisted heating processes give better results than conventional heating ones, affording endo-cycloadducts as major stereoisomers. In general, 2,5-cis-cycloadducts are preferentially formed according to the previous formation of the W-shaped dipole. Only in the 1,3-DC of the disulfone with phenylglycine and ethyl glyoxylate the corresponding exo-trans-cycloadduct was isolated. The compound endo-cis-4b, derived from phenylalanine, ethyl glyoxylate and N-benzylmaleimide, has been further transformed into a very complex diazabicyclo[2.2.1]octane skeleton with potential biological activity.

El objetivo del trabajo consiste en reutilizar el Treebank de dependencias EPECDEP (BDT) para construir el gold standard de la sintaxis superficial del euskera. El paso básico consiste en el estudio comparativo de los dos formalismos aplicados sobre el mismo corpus: el formalismo de la Gramática de Restricciones (Constraint Grammar, CG) y la Gramática de Dependencias (Dependency Grammar, DP). Como resultado de dicho estudio hemos establecido los criterios lingüísticos necesarios para derivar la funciones sintácticas en estilo CG. Dichos criterios han sido implementados y evaluados, así en el 75% de los casos se derivan automáticamente las funciones sintácticas para construir el gold standard.

Carbon and graphene-based materials often show some amount of pseudocapacitance due to their oxygen-functional groups. However, such pseudocapacitance is generally negligible in organic electrolytes and has not attracted much attention. In this work, we report a large pseudocapacitance of zeolite-templated carbon (ZTC) based on the oxygen-functional groups in 1 M tetraethylammonium tetrafluoroborate dissolved in propylene carbonate (Et4NBF4/PC). Due to its significant amount of active edge sites, a large amount of redox-active oxygen functional groups are introduced into ZTC, and ZTC shows a high specific capacitance (330 F g−1). Experimental results suggest that the pseudocapacitance could be based on the formation of anion and cation radicals of quinones and ethers, respectively. Moreover, ZTC shows pseudocapacitance also in 1 M lithium hexafluorophosphate dissolved with a mixture of ethylene carbonate and diethyl carbonate (LiPF6/EC+DEC) which is used for lithium-ion batteries and lithium-ion capacitors.

"L'Encarnella", revista satírica. Coleccion completa de seis numeros. 1983-1984: Número 1: “L’Encarnella entrega. Fulla oligofrènica per als bufats”, núm. 1.001, abril 1983. Tinta de color verde-gris oscuro. 4 p. + un encarte impreso a doble cara de 22 x 16 mm. Dep. Leg. A-229-1983. Número 2: “L’Encarnella encarnà. La revista més oberta per al lector més estret”, núm. 2.001, junio 1983. Tinta de color rojo vivo. 4 p. + un encarte impreso a una cara de 420 x 295 mm. Dep. Leg. A-514-1983. Número 3. “L’Encarnella festera. La fulla de got i punyal”, núm. 3.001, agosto 1983. Tinta de color morado oscuro. 4 p. Dep. Leg. A-714-1983. Número 4: “El rabo de l’encarnella. La fulla més verda per al lector més morat”, núm. 4.004, octubre 1983. Tinta de color verde brillante. 4 p. Dep. Leg. A-843-1983. Número 5: “Encarnelles blanques. Extra de navidad… con cotillón sorpresa. La revista que no produeix ressaca”, núm. 5.005, diciembre 1983. Tinta de color azul-negro oscuro. 8 p. + un encarte efímero consistente en un puñado de confetis sueltos de colores que le caían encima al lector cuando abría el ejemplar. Dep. Leg. A-1097-1983. Número 6: “L’Encarnella rostía. La fulla que no falla”, núm. 6.006, marzo 1983. Tinta de color azul oscuro. 4 p. Dep. Leg. A-164-1984.
